Strikes in Italy to affect air travel, trains and local public transport in October
Italy faces series of transport strikes in October.People travelling and commuting in Italy this October face disruption due to a series of strikes affecting air travel, trains and local public transport services.Here are the main transport strikes to watch out for in Italy during October 2025.
3 October: General strike
A 24-hour national general strike is set to affect rail services operated by Trenitalia,Ā ItaloĀ andĀ TrenordĀ from 21.00 on Thursday 2 October until the same time on Friday 3 October.
Italy's national state-owned railway holding company Ferrovie dello Stato (FS) said in a statement thatĀ the walkoutĀ couldĀ lead to timetable changes "even before and after" the strike times.
Regional rail services are guaranteed in Italy during strikes on weekdays from 06.00 to 09.00 and from 18.00 to 21.00.
The strike has been called by the S.I. Cobas trade union in "support of the Palestinian resistance" and demanding an "end to the genocide" in Gaza.
10 October: Local public transport strike in RomeĀ
Commuters and tourists in RomeĀ can expect disruption to local public transport services on Friday 10 October due to a 24-hour strike.
The industrial action, called byĀ USB Lavoro Privato and ORSA Tpl, will impact the Italian capital's bus, subway and tram services operated by municipal transport provider ATAC.Ā
13 October: Airport staff strike in Rome
Air travellers passing through Rome on Monday 13 October could experience disruption due to a four-hour strike by employees of Aeroporti di Roma (AdR) which manages the capital's Fiumicino and Ciampino airports.
The strike, called by the FAST / CONFSAL unions, will see AdR staff go strike from midday until 16.00.
29 October: Airport strikes in Milan Linate, Florence and Pisa
Passengers travelling through the airports of Milan Linate, Florence and Pisa on Wednesday 29 October could face disruption due to 24-hour strike action by airport staff in a walkout organised by numerous trade unions.
